Gemalto Sentinel HASP keys, specifically identified by codes like Batch or Feature 79200, represent a cornerstone in hardware-based software protection and licensing. Developed by SafeNet (later acquired by Gemalto, and subsequently part of Thales Group), the Sentinel HASP (Hardware Against Software Piracy) system is designed to prevent unauthorized copying, distribution, and use of high-value software.
